Jianlong Chang is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Electrical and Electronic Engineering. According to data from OpenAlex, Jianlong Chang has authored 37 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Computer Vision and Pattern Recognition, 16 papers in Artificial Intelligence and 5 papers in Electrical and Electronic Engineering. Recurrent topics in Jianlong Chang's work include Advanced Neural Network Applications (12 papers), Domain Adaptation and Few-Shot Learning (7 papers) and Advanced Image and Video Retrieval Techniques (7 papers). Jianlong Chang is often cited by papers focused on Advanced Neural Network Applications (12 papers), Domain Adaptation and Few-Shot Learning (7 papers) and Advanced Image and Video Retrieval Techniques (7 papers). Jianlong Chang collaborates with scholars based in China, Australia and United States. Jianlong Chang's co-authors include Shiming Xiang, Chunhong Pan, Gaofeng Meng, Lingfeng Wang, Qi Tian, Jian Cheng, Yang Yang, Qi Zhang, Guan-An Wang and Liang Xu and has published in prestigious journals such as IEEE Transactions on Pattern Analysis and Machine Intelligence, Advanced Energy Materials and IEEE Transactions on Image Processing.
